mixing valve in a faucet: ok I will assume you are refering to a shower valve, that is the only faucet w/a mixing valve:
shut off the hot and cold water.
cut out valve or unsweat it.
clean and flux new valve, pipe and fittings(if used)
sweat in new valve
The incoming hot and cold lines go to separate inlets on the mixing valve. The single output will go to both the spigot and the shower head.
A shower faucet typically consists of a handle, a cartridge, and a mixing valve. The handle is used to adjust the water flow and temperature. The cartridge controls the flow of water by opening and closing the valve inside the faucet. The mixing valve blends hot and cold water to achieve the desired temperature. Together, these parts work to regulate the flow and temperature of water in the shower.

The key steps involved in thermostatic mixing valve installation include: Shutting off the water supply to the area where the valve will be installed. Removing the existing valve or faucet. Installing the new thermostatic mixing valve according to the manufacturer's instructions. Connecting the hot and cold water supply lines to the valve. Testing the valve to ensure it is functioning properly. Adjusting the temperature settings as needed. Restoring water supply and checking for leaks.
The faucet valve seat is a small component that creates a seal with the faucet's valve to control the flow of water. It helps prevent leaks and ensures smooth operation of the faucet by providing a tight closure when the faucet is turned off. This contributes to the overall functionality of the faucet by maintaining water pressure and preventing wastage.

To perform a Moen faucet valve replacement, first turn off the water supply to the faucet. Remove the handle and trim to access the valve. Use a wrench to unscrew and remove the old valve. Install the new valve by screwing it in place and reassemble the handle and trim. Turn the water supply back on and test the faucet for leaks.

To fix a leaking faucet valve in your bathroom, you can start by turning off the water supply to the faucet. Next, disassemble the faucet handle and valve to inspect for any worn or damaged parts. Replace any faulty components, such as the O-ring or washer, and reassemble the faucet. Turn the water supply back on and test the faucet to ensure the leak is fixed.
